Avatar billede riversen Nybegynder
16. januar 2003 - 12:47 Der er 8 kommentarer og
1 løsning

Sende et objekt videre fra en form

Jeg har en form på en side...jeg kan sagtens sende samtlige parametre videre til en ny side, men er det ikke muligt at lave et objekt ved tryk på send knappen og så sende objektet videre til næste side...så adressen bliver mere simpel og skjuler alle variabler i objektet.
Avatar billede sthen Nybegynder
16. januar 2003 - 13:11 #1
Så er du nødt til at bruge sessions

Læs evt. her
http://www.razor.dk/php.tutorials.sessions.php
Avatar billede jakoba Nybegynder
16. januar 2003 - 13:21 #2
mestendels NEJ.

Idet du siger 'send' bliver den nuværendede side og alle dens variable og indtastede data slettet. hvis du skal bruge de data på den side der derefter bliver indlæst må du 'gemme' dem etsted imens der skiftes side.

det kan gøres på severen, eller i en rammeside der ikke skifter, eller i den url du beder om den næste side med, eller i en cookie. fælles for metoderne er at du skal pakke ind og ud igen, og du skal være opmærksom på de ulemper der følger med de forskellige metoder.

på serveren:
    kræver at du har adgang til at programmere serverside.
i en ramme:
    der skal benyttes frames (eller en popop). Der skal adresseres med javascript imellem siderne.
i en url:
    du får en grim adresselinie på den næste side.
i cookie:
    risikabelt da mange brugere har cookies slået fra.

ingen af ovenstående er rigtig det 'sende et objekt' du lægger op til, men alle er mulige, vælg mellem krav/bagdele hvilken du kan leve med.

mvh JakobA
Avatar billede riversen Nybegynder
16. januar 2003 - 13:43 #3
ok, jeg nøjes med url så
Avatar billede camillap Nybegynder
16. januar 2003 - 14:17 #4
jacoba, kan man ikke bare bruke

<input type=hidden name="ID" value="<? echo $ID ?>">

etc??

så får man jo alle variabler send til den neste side uten at URL blir endret?..
Avatar billede jakoba Nybegynder
16. januar 2003 - 14:26 #5
jo det kan man, data 'gemmes' på serveren og bliver sendt med til den næste side der hentes til browseren.
Avatar billede riversen Nybegynder
16. januar 2003 - 16:33 #6
sthen: mht sessions...der opstår ingen problemer, hvis 2 er koble på samtidig?
Avatar billede riversen Nybegynder
18. januar 2003 - 15:13 #7
jeg lukker
Avatar billede riversen Nybegynder
18. januar 2003 - 15:13 #8
svar :-)
Avatar billede riversen Nybegynder
18. januar 2003 - 15:13 #9
hmmm
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ester